Overview

The Madhya Pradesh Public Service Commission (MPPSC) has released the State Eligibility Test (SET) 2025 notification for candidates seeking eligibility for Assistant Professor, Librarian & related academic roles in universities and colleges across Madhya Pradesh. The online registration started in October 2025 and the deadline for submission has been extended to give more time to candidates who haven’t applied yet. Qualified candidates will be eligible to appear in the SET exam scheduled for January 2026.

Important Dates

EventDate
Online Application Start25 October 2025
Original Last Date20 November 2025
Extended Last Date27 November 2025
Last Date for Fee Payment27 November 2025 (extended deadline)
Correction Window30 October – 22 November 2025
Last Date with 1st Late Fee28 November 2025 (₹3,000)
Last Date with 2nd Late FeeUp to 10 days before exam (₹25,000)
Exam Date11 January 2026

Application Fee

CategoryFee (₹)
General / Other State₹500 + Portal Charges
MP Reserve Category₹250 + Portal Charges
Portal Charge₹40 (approx)
Correction Charge₹50 per correction
First Time Late Fee₹3,000 (approx)
Second Time Late Fee₹25,000 (approx)
Mode of PaymentOnline (Debit Card / Credit Card / Net Banking / MP Online Kiosk)

Total Posts / Vacancies

This is an eligibility test (SET) that certifies candidates’ eligibility for teaching and related academic positions. No specific number of vacancies / posts is directly associated with the SET itself — seats and recruitment vacancies are filled through separate processes by universities, colleges, and MPPSC as per requirement.

Exam Structure

The SET exam typically includes:

  • Paper I: General Teaching and Research Aptitude
  • Paper II: Subject-Specific (based on chosen discipline)
